NHPs are the only clinically-relevant model for assessing immune-related toxicity, allowing preclinical evaluation of potentially fatal clinical toxicities e.g. cytokine storm. NHPs have a high homology to humans, fully intact immune system, and cross-reactivity to antibodies which are not recapitulated in rodents or other larger animal models.

Comprehensive Non-GLP Analysis
Assess the immuno-safety of a range of I/O agents including mAbs, CAR-T cell therapies, ADCs, vaccines, small molecules, cytokines, and oncolytic viruses using:
- Healthy immunocompetent cynomolgus macaques
- A range of common administration routes
- Intravenous injection or infusion
- Intramuscular injection
- Subcutaneous injection
- Oral routes – via diet or gavage
- Perform FACS and immunoprofiling of common immune cell markers including cytokines, CD markers, immune checkpoint targets with fast turnaround on additional marker validation
- Analyze serum markers using industry gold standards: Beckman Coulter AU480 clinical chemistry analyzer, Luminex, MesoScale Discovery single and multi-plex systems
- Perform clinical observations to identify potential adverse effects related to cytokine storm/CRS
- Changes in heart rate and/or body temperature
- Facial redness or swelling
- Vomiting, diarrhea, tremor, lethargy, low blood pressure, difficulty breathing
